Hello
I am in the process of creating a joomla site using Joomla 1.5.15. I downloaded the free SEF patch for 1.5.15 patch_1515_stable.zip.
I tried to install it through the installer and got JFolder::files: Path does not point to a valid folder or the folder has been deleted.
JFolder::folder: Path does not point to a valid folder or the folder has been deleted.
JFolder::files: Path does not point to a valid folder or the folder has been deleted.
Error! Could not find a Joomla! XML setup file in the package.
I saw another post that said to upload the files manually. However, when I try to extract the zip (Windows Vista) I get
Cannot complete the comppressed zipped files extraction wizard
the compressed (zipped) folder is empty
The file shows as being 62kb.
I'd appreciate any thoughts on this.

I SOLVED IT. I think you have a problem with your zips.
I downloaded Winrar on another machine . I also redownloaded 1515 and 1514 stable.
1. Winrar test said that the archives were OK.
2. The Winrar extract did not result in a folder structure like the 1510 stable I had downloaded a while back. It just left me with a file called patch_1515_stable.
3. The file was only slightly smaller than the zip I downloaded. I suspected that someone probably zipped a zip file.
4. I changed the extension of the file that winrar extract from no extension to .zip
5. Ran an extract all against the patch_1515_stable.zip and it succesfully extracted the folders and files.
Again, I think that the zips are zips of zips and not zips of the folder structure

What I think happened was:
The original folder and file structure was zipped
The .zip extension was removed from the archive (Patch_0115-stable.zip was renamed to patch_0115_stable)
Patch_0115_stable was zipped and resulted in an archive of patch_0115_stable.zip
The end result appears to be that the folder structure and files were archived twice
To get the files from the archive I
1. Ran winrar on the archive as downloaded. That resulted in only one file extracted called patch_0115_stable
2. I renamed the extracted patch_0115_stable to patch_0115_stable.zip
3. I ran the windows extract against the renamed file. That gave me the files and folder structure.
I know that seems weird but it worked.
